1 进入数据库
默认安装会创建postgres 用户,,使用postgres用户,psql命令会直接进入数据库
(或者修改配置文件/var/lib/pgsql/9.1/data/pg_hba.conf 将peer或别的改为trust,否则会提示错误Peer authentication failed for user “postgres”),修改客户端认证配置文件,将METHOD由默认的ident改为md5 使用 psql -U posrgres 进入)
$ su postgres //psql用户 $ psql //默认可直接进入 $ psql -U posrgres -d dbname //使用psql命令进去如数据库管理
2 显示数据库
$ \l
3 选择使用某数据库
\c dbname
4 显示数据表
$ \dt
5为postgres用户添加密码
$ \password postgre
修改 vim /etc/postgresql/9.1/main/pg_hba.conf 中的 peer 模式为 md5
相关推荐
### PostgreSQL常用命令详解 #### 一、数据库与表管理 **1. \d [table]** - **功能**: 列出当前数据库中的所有表,或者如果指定了特定的表名,则列出该表的列/字段。 - **示例**: `\d` 显示所有表;`\d table_...
本文详细介绍了PostgreSQL中常用的命令,涵盖了表和数据库对象管理、编辑与文件操作以及其他实用命令等多个方面。这些命令不仅能够帮助用户高效地管理和查询数据库,还能够提高日常开发和维护工作的效率。通过熟悉...
- 配置环境变量以便可以方便地从命令行调用PostgreSQL的命令。 2. 配置PostgreSQL - 设置监听地址和端口号。 - 配置允许远程连接和认证方式。 - 修改iptables配置文件允许远程访问指定端口。 - 设置PostgreSQL...
### PostgreSQL 学习总结及命令应用 #### 一、PostgreSQL 安装指南 ...以上就是关于 PostgreSQL 的安装、配置 phppgadmin 以及命令行操作的基本知识总结。希望这些信息能够帮助读者更好地掌握 PostgreSQL 的使用技巧。
在Linux环境下,管理和操作PostgreSQL主要依赖于一系列的命令行工具。这些工具涵盖了从数据库的创建、用户管理、数据备份与恢复,到数据库的日常维护等多个方面。 1. 用户实用程序: - `createdb`:用于创建新的...
### 三、常用psql命令 - **连接数据库** ``` psql -U <username> -d ``` - **列出所有数据库** ``` \l ``` - **切换数据库** ``` \c ``` - **显示当前数据库** ``` \dx ``` - **退出psql** ...
根据提供的文件信息,“postgresql安装”这一主题涉及到的是如何在特定的操作系统上安装并配置PostgreSQL数据库管理系统。PostgreSQL是一款开源的对象关系型数据库系统,以其稳定性、功能强大和遵循SQL标准而闻名。...
### PostgreSQL 官方文档知识点概览 #### 一、PostgreSQL 概述 - **定义与定位**:PostgreSQL是一款开源的关系型...无论是希望了解PostgreSQL的基本操作还是深入研究其复杂功能,这份文档都是不可或缺的参考指南。
**PostgreSQL 概念** PostgreSQL,简称 Postgres,是一种...以上是 PostgreSQL 的基本概念、安装方法和常用操作。随着对 PostgreSQL 的深入使用,你会发现在高级特性、性能调优、复制和集群等方面还有更多的学习空间。
在Python中,最常用且推荐的库是 `psycopg2`,它允许程序员用Python代码来执行SQL查询,实现对数据库的连接、增删改查等操作。 首先,要使用 `psycopg2` 模块,你需要确保已经正确安装。在命令行中运行 `pip3 ...
- **psql命令行快速参考**:常用命令一览。 - **psql内部命令快速参考**:了解内置命令。 - **设置ODBC**:配置ODBC数据源以连接PostgreSQL。 ##### pgAdminIII - **安装pgAdminIII**:安装步骤。 - **使用...
- psql:命令行工具,直接与PostgreSQL服务器交互,执行SQL命令和管理任务。 6. **开发与集成** - 驱动支持:PostgreSQL支持多种编程语言的驱动,如Python的psycopg2,Java的JDBC,PHP的PDO等,方便与其他应用...
在命令行操作的场景下,我们通常会利用Qt的API来编写程序,而非直接在终端执行SQL命令。下面将详细解释这个过程。 1. **QSqlDatabase类**: 这是Qt数据库模块的核心,用于建立和管理数据库连接。首先,我们需要实例...
- **创建用户组**:通过 `groupadd` 命令创建用户组 `postgresql`。 ```bash groupadd postgresql ``` - **创建用户**:使用 `useradd` 命令创建用户 `postgres`,并将其添加到 `postgresql` 用户组中。 ```bash...
- **常用命令** - `\l`:查看当前系统中存在的所有数据库。 - `\q`:退出`psql`客户端。 - `\c`:从一个数据库转换到另一个数据库。 - `\dt`:查看数据库中的表。 - `\d`:查看表结构。 通过以上步骤,您可以...
备份PostgreSQL数据库常用`pg_dump`命令,例如: ```bash pg_dump mydatabase > mydatabase.dump ``` 恢复时使用`pg_restore`: ```bash pg_restore -d mydatabase mydatabase.dump ``` ## 7. 插件和扩展 ...